THE STORY:
The First Stage Bard-o-Thon will take place Saturday, April 21st at the Milwaukee Youth Arts Center - 325 W Walnut St, Milwaukee WI 53212.
At the First Stage Bard-o-thon, students will perform as many memorized Shakespearean monologues in a row as possible. Performers will include the Young Company, First Stage Theater Academy's advanced, pre-professional actor training program for high school students as well as other members of the Theater Academy.
First Stage students will be collecting sponsorships or pledges based on the number of monologues they will be performing, and many students hope to perform at least ten consecutive monologues, which is nearly the equivalent of an entire Shakespeare play! Well, maybe not, but it's still very impressive. Monologues will be peformed at the MIlwaukee Youth Arts Center from 1-5 with a showcase of the day's monologues at 6 pm. The public is welcome to come and watch at any time!
